PINT10_FREE_BUFFER fonction de rappel (video.h)

La fonction Int10FreeBuffer libère une mémoire tampon précédemment allouée par Int10AllocateBuffer.

Syntaxe

PINT10_FREE_BUFFER Pint10FreeBuffer;

VP_STATUS Pint10FreeBuffer(
  [in] IN PVOID Context,
  [in] IN USHORT Seg,
  [in] IN USHORT Off
)
{...}

Paramètres

[in] Context

Pointeur vers un contexte défini par le pilote de port vidéo pour l’interface. Il doit s’agir de la même valeur que dans le membre de contexte de la structure VIDEO_PORT_INT10_INTERFACE après que VideoPortQueryServices retourne.

[in] Seg

Spécifie l’adresse de segment de la mémoire tampon à libérer.

[in] Off

Spécifie le décalage dans le segment indiqué par le paramètre Seg .

Valeur de retour

La fonction Int10FreeBuffer retourne NO_ERROR en cas de réussite. Sinon, la fonction retourne un code d’erreur approprié.

Remarques

Le port vidéo implémente cette fonction, accessible via un pointeur dans la structure VIDEO_PORT_INT10_INTERFACE .

Configuration requise

   
Client minimal pris en charge Disponible dans Windows 2000 et versions ultérieures des systèmes d’exploitation Windows.
Plateforme cible Desktop (Expérience utilisateur)
En-tête video.h (include Video.h)
IRQL PASSIVE_LEVEL

Voir aussi

VIDEO_PORT_INT10_INTERFACE